"In Thy will is our peace."
— Dante

More Quotemeal

"In prayer it is better to have a heart without words than words without a heart."
John Bunyan
"Man may dismiss compassion from his heart, but God never will."
"God always gives His best to those who leave the choice with Him."
Jim Elliot
"Sin will take you farther than you want to go, keep you longer than you want to stay, and cost you more than you want to pay."
